Ticket: Vault lockout blocking compaction config. The Brindlequeue log compaction settings for plugin topics live in the Stonebox vault, which is currently locked after three failed attempts. Plugin authors cannot adjust retention until it's reopened. Per the Hollis escalation process, unlocking requires the shared recovery passphrase, reproduced below for authorized reviewers:

recovery phrase for fafof-kagaf: eliath-zormir

Ticket #4471 — Vault locked after drift-calibration deploy

Hey, while reviewing the GrowCell controller patch for humidity sensor drift, I managed to trip the config vault's lockout by fat-fingering the unseal three times. The drift offsets are stored in there, so the fix can't merge until it's reopened. Per the Thornbury runbook, recovery needs the passphrase, which is included below.

unlock words, yawig-kagef: gordor-holvan-ulaael-pramir-ulaiel-tamdor

Visitor Policy — Cleaning Crew Access. The cleaning team from Bramlow Services attends Wexcombe House each weekday evening from 19:00. Visiting contractors working after hours should expect cleaners on all floors and must not prop open secure doors for them. If the crew arrives while reception is closed, admit them through the rear entrance using the code below.

door code, yagap-bahof: bdg-O-05

Handover note — Crumbwheel order cutoffs.

Welcome aboard. The bakery cutoff rule in Crumbwheel closes same-day orders at 14:00 local to each storefront, not UTC — this has bitten us twice. Holiday overrides live in the calendar service and take precedence silently, so always check there first when a cutoff looks wrong. To unlock the calendar service's admin console after a restart, enter the recovery passphrase below.

vault phrase of bagap-bahaf = silion-pelox-sorox-casdor-quenwyn-fraax-eliox-praael-kelion-quenvan-kasox-rusael-norius-belvan

**Mgmt Meeting Minutes — Retiring the Brightline Range**

Quick recap for sales leads at Fenholt Supplies: we agreed to retire the Brightline fixture range by year-end. Remaining stock moves to clearance pricing next month, and accounts on standing orders get migrated to the Lumetta range. Trade-in incentives were approved in principle. The confidential note on next steps sits just below.

board note of bajof-bajeg: The pricing group signed off on a budget of $13.4 million for Project Sildor. The renewal with Lamixek Holdings closes at $48.9 million a year, 49 percent above the last contract.